VIDEO: car fire in Goring

The owner of a car that caught fire in Goring Road, Goring this morning, frantically pulled out his possessions before the car went up in flames.

Bob Dodds, of Kelso Close, Tarring, had parked outside Spar while he went to get a sandwich.

On his return the car was on fire.

He said: “I was desperate to get my Miracle sails out of the car because you cannot replace them- the manufacturer is no longer is business so it was very important for me to retrieve them.

“Now I will have to try and get hold of my insurance company so that the remains of the car can be towed.

“Firefighter Roy Barraclough happened to be passing so stopped to help by doing what he could.

“I dread to think what would have happened if I had been going along the motorway. I would have been in trouble because it went up in flames so quickly.”
